Description
4-Methylesculetin is an orally active natural coumarin derivative, with potent anti-oxidant and anti-inflammatory activities. 4-Methylesculetin inhibits myeloperoxidase activity and reduces IL-6 level[1].
6,7-dihydroxy-4-methylcoumarin is a hydroxycoumarin that is 4-methylcuomarin which is substituted by hydroxy groups at positions 3 and 4. A hyaluronan synthesis inhibitor. It has also been used as a fluorescent sensor to monitor the consumption of a boronic acid in Suzuki coupling reactions; fluorescence is readily detectable by the naked eye using a standard 365 nm UV lamp. It has a role as a hyaluronan synthesis inhibitor, an antioxidant and an anti-inflammatory agent.

4-Methylesculetin Use and Manufacturing
From benzoquinone and acetic anhydride in the presence of concentrated acid to generate phenyl triacetate. Under the action of dilute sulfuric acid, it reacts with ethyl acetoacetate, the reactant is poured into ice water to precipitate the crude methyl esculetine, and the filtered crystals are recrystallized with water to obtain the finished product.
Used as a fluorescent indicator.
